Understanding the Role of HPMC 60SH-50 in Improving Suspension Stability in Liquid Formulations

Suspension stability is a critical factor in liquid formulations, as it determines the shelf life and effectiveness of the product. One key ingredient that plays a significant role in improving suspension stability is HPMC 60SH-50. In this article, we will delve into the understanding of how HPMC 60SH-50 enhances suspension stability in liquid formulations.

HPMC, or hydroxypropyl methylcellulose, is a cellulose-based polymer that is widely used in the pharmaceutical, cosmetic, and food industries. It is known for its excellent film-forming, thickening, and stabilizing properties. HPMC 60SH-50 is a specific grade of HPMC that is commonly used in liquid formulations to improve suspension stability.

One of the primary reasons why HPMC 60SH-50 is effective in enhancing suspension stability is its ability to increase viscosity. Viscosity refers to the resistance of a liquid to flow, and in the case of liquid formulations, higher viscosity helps to prevent the settling of solid particles. When HPMC 60SH-50 is added to a liquid formulation, it forms a gel-like network that traps the solid particles, preventing them from settling at the bottom of the container. This ensures that the suspension remains uniform and stable throughout the shelf life of the product.

Furthermore, HPMC 60SH-50 also acts as a protective colloid. A protective colloid is a substance that forms a protective layer around the solid particles, preventing them from coming into contact with each other. This layer reduces the attractive forces between the particles, thereby preventing aggregation and settling. By acting as a protective colloid, HPMC 60SH-50 helps to maintain the suspension stability by keeping the solid particles dispersed evenly throughout the liquid.

Another important aspect of HPMC 60SH-50 is its compatibility with a wide range of solvents. This makes it suitable for use in various liquid formulations, including aqueous, organic, and hydroalcoholic systems. Its compatibility ensures that it can be easily incorporated into different formulations without causing any adverse effects on the stability or performance of the product.

In addition to its role in improving suspension stability, HPMC 60SH-50 also offers other benefits in liquid formulations. It can enhance the rheological properties of the formulation, providing a desirable texture and flow behavior. It can also improve the mouthfeel and sensory attributes of the product, making it more appealing to consumers.

To conclude, HPMC 60SH-50 is a valuable ingredient in liquid formulations due to its ability to improve suspension stability. Its viscosity-enhancing properties, protective colloid action, and compatibility with various solvents make it an ideal choice for maintaining the uniformity and stability of suspensions. Furthermore, its additional benefits in terms of rheological properties and sensory attributes make it a versatile ingredient in the formulation of liquid products. By understanding the role of HPMC 60SH-50 in improving suspension stability, formulators can create high-quality liquid formulations that meet the expectations of consumers.

Key Factors to Consider When Utilizing HPMC 60SH-50 to Enhance Suspension Stability in Liquid Formulations

How HPMC 60SH-50 Improves Suspension Stability in Liquid Formulations

Suspension stability is a critical factor to consider when formulating liquid products. Whether it’s a pharmaceutical drug, a cosmetic product, or an industrial solution, maintaining the uniform distribution of solid particles in a liquid is essential for the product’s effectiveness and shelf life. One effective way to enhance suspension stability is by utilizing Hydroxypropyl Methylcellulose (HPMC) 60SH-50.

HPMC 60SH-50 is a cellulose-based polymer that is widely used in various industries due to its excellent film-forming and thickening properties. When added to liquid formulations, it acts as a stabilizer, preventing the settling of solid particles and ensuring a homogeneous distribution throughout the product.

One key factor to consider when utilizing HPMC 60SH-50 is its high viscosity. The viscosity of a liquid formulation plays a crucial role in suspension stability. A higher viscosity helps to slow down the settling of solid particles, allowing them to remain suspended for a longer period. HPMC 60SH-50, with its high viscosity, effectively increases the resistance to sedimentation, ensuring that the particles stay evenly dispersed in the liquid.

Another important factor to consider is the concentration of HPMC 60SH-50 in the formulation. The optimal concentration depends on the specific requirements of the product and the desired suspension stability. Generally, a higher concentration of HPMC 60SH-50 leads to better suspension stability. However, it is essential to strike a balance as an excessive concentration may result in increased viscosity, making the product too thick and difficult to handle.

The particle size of the solid particles in the formulation also plays a significant role in suspension stability. Smaller particles tend to settle more slowly than larger ones due to their increased surface area and reduced settling velocity. HPMC 60SH-50 helps to maintain suspension stability by creating a protective barrier around the particles, preventing them from agglomerating and settling. This barrier effect is particularly effective for smaller particles, ensuring their uniform distribution throughout the liquid.
